‘The Great Family Get Together Show’ to be held on INDIA Alliance Rally – Pratul Shah Deo

Ranchi: BJP launched a major attack on the April 21 rally organized by India Alliance and called it The Great Family Get Together Show.

While addressing the press conference at State Media Centre, Harmu, and State Spokesperson Pratul Shah Dev said that on this stage, Akhilesh Yadav’s family, Lalu Prasad’s family, Stalin’s family, Mamata Banerjee’s family, Hemant Soren’s family along with Gandhi were present.

The family will be seen.

Pratul said that this is just a group of parties that want to promote the family and have come together on one platform due to the fear of Prime Minister Narendra Modi launching a big campaign against corruption in the entire country.

Taking on the opposition on electoral bonds, Pratul said that the opposition speaks by hiding things.

A total of 3000 companies had bought Electrol bonds.

In which only 26 companies are under investigation by ED, CBI or IT.

Out of these, 16 companies had bought Electrol bonds after the raid. BJP got only 37 percent of the electoral bonds purchased by these 16 companies while the opponents got 63 percent.

Pratul said that if we put together the sequence, it seems that the opposition is going to the places where raids are conducted by these agencies and after coming to power, they are making recovery in the name of closing the case.

That is why such raiding companies have started 2/3rd of the bonds were given to Congress and Indi Alliance parties.
